NEW Drop-off/Pick-up Procedures

Before School:

  • Please use the student drop-off line.  In the past, we have had ECSE buses in the loop until 8:25.  That is no longer the case.  So parents, feel free to pull up into our circle as early as 8:15, but remember, kids shouldn't exit your car until 8:25 because we don't have staff available to supervise them until that time.  At 8:25, they can get out of your car and enter the building.  Hopefully, not having cars wait at the lamppost (like previous years) will cut down on the traffic that reaches out to Courtland at that time of day, but some of that is inevitable.  We're a busy school!
  • Please don't drop off kids in the parking lot and expect them to find their way to the front of the school.  Bypassing our student drop-off line might feel like it saves you a couple minutes in the morning, but our staff has witnessed kids tripping in the parking lot behind cars that are attempting to back up from their spots.  It's just not safe.  Please use our drop-off line.

After School:

  • Please use the line for Parent Pick-Up.  Even if it takes a couple extra minutes.  This is the safest way to pick up your child.
  • Kindergarten Parents can pull into the traffic circle as early as 3:20.  We officially dismiss at 3:32, but our kindergarten students are dismissed a little early (around 3:30).  We like to load them first before all other students exit the building.  (If you have multiple students, including a kindergartner, we'd ask that you wait with the other cars so the kindergarten-only families can board and depart.
  • All Other Parents should wait until 3:30 to enter the circle.  As you've done in the past, please wait along the right side of our entrance drive (behind the entrance to the bus loop) until 3:30.  At that time you can pull forward.
  • Please pull all the way forward.  Even if you see your child, please pull forward as far as you can to allow us to board as many students as possible at one time.  This will help the line move most efficiently.
  • If you do insist on parking in the parking lot (not recommended), please come across the crosswalk to pick up your child.  Unattended students should not be crossing the road.
  • Parents who are waiting for their child to exit the building should remain north of the crosswalk.  This allows kids to see their cars and doesn't confuse parents with the staff members who are helping the kids safely get to their cars.
  • Use the crosswalk exclusively.  No one, staff, students, or parents, should be cutting between cars to get to the parking lot.  This is essential!!!

Extra Clothing

It is recommended that ALL students K-5 keep extra, weather appropriate, clothes in their locker (shirt, pants, underwear, socks, & shoes). Students may need to change due to bathroom accidents, spills in the cafeteria, or getting wet/dirty at recess. We no longer have a Care Closet at the building so having these clothes on hand is highly recommended.
